OCTOBER MEETING: Monday, October 28, 2019 at 6:30pm in Chambers Hall, Evanston
DATA SCIENCE NIGHTS are monthly hack nights on popular data science topics, organized by Northwestern University graduate students and scholars. Aspiring, beginning, and advanced data scientists are welcome!
SPEAKER: This month we are hosting Research Assistant Professor Carlos Gallo from the Department of Psychiatry and Behavioral Sciences at the Feinberg School of Medicine, Northwestern University.
TOPIC: "Improving suicide prevention services via online chat: a text mining approach"

About the Speaker Series:
Wednesdays@NICO is a vibrant weekly seminar series focusing broadly on the topics of complex systems, data science and network science. It brings together attendees ranging from graduate students to senior faculty who span all of the schools across Northwestern, from applied math to sociology to biology and every discipline in-between.
